Lisbon's boutique hotel scene pairs bold contemporary design with the city's historic soul. Expect individually styled rooms-some with original artwork, others with floor-to-ceiling windows framing Avenida da Liberdade. Many properties sit within walking distance of landmarks like Parque Eduardo VII and the Chiado district, offering rooftop pools, on-site spas, and breakfast buffets with local pastries. Guest scores typically range from 8.4 to 9.0, reflecting consistent quality across service and amenities.
Budget for these stays: rates vary from mid-range to upscale, but the value lies in central addresses and thoughtful extras like iMac workstations, airport shuttles, or private parking. Top-rated picks include Browns Downtown Hotel (9.0, Superb) near the historic center, Epic Sana Lisboa Hotel (8.8, Superb) with two pools, and HF Fenix Urban (8.8, Superb) just steps from Eduardo VII Park. For a refined stay, Sheraton Lisboa Hotel & Spa (8.6, Fabulous) offers a 1,500-square-meter spa, while Tivoli Oriente Lisboa (8.8, Superb) pairs sky bar views with metro access. Book early for summer, and check if breakfast or parking is included-many boutiques bundle these perks.
